What demographic trend is influencing the luxury market according to McKinsey's 2025 report?

Explanation:
The influence of younger consumers on luxury expectations is significant, as outlined in McKinsey's 2025 report. This demographic trend highlights how millennials and Generation Z have distinct values, preferences, and shopping habits that are reshaping the luxury market. Younger consumers prioritize authenticity, sustainability, and social responsibility, which drives luxury brands to innovate and respond to these values. They are also more engaged in digital platforms and social media, leading brands to enhance their online presence and digital marketing strategies to cater to this audience effectively. As a result, understanding and catering to the expectations of younger consumers becomes crucial for luxury brands aiming to remain relevant and appealing in a competitive marketplace.
